Seat Selection
To select a seat when purchasing a flight ticket, you first need to complete the preliminary booking. Once that's done, the "Select Seat" button will appear in your account.
Please note that seat selection is not available for all passengers—availability depends on the airline and fare class. If seat selection isn't available during the initial booking process, you can also choose your seat during online check-in, which typically opens 24–36 hours before departure.
Booking for Infants
Infant with a Seat
If you need to book a flight ticket for an infant with a seat, follow these steps:
- Create the booking as a child by entering a date of birth that corresponds to age 2.
- Do not issue the ticket yet.
- Add a comment to the order in your Personal Account with the infant's correct date of birth.
- The ticket will be issued with a seat, and our managers will manually update the birth date to the correct one.
This workaround ensures your infant has a reserved seat while maintaining accurate passenger information.
Infant Turning 2 During the Trip
If your child turns 2 years old during the trip, this must be clarified before booking. The rules for booking an infant in this situation vary between airlines, so it's essential to check the specific requirements with us beforehand to ensure proper ticketing and avoid any issues at the airport.
Adding Baggage to an Issued Order
If you need to add baggage to an order that has already been issued, submit a comment to the order in your Personal Account. In your comment, include:
- The weight of the baggage
- The quantity (number of pieces)
- The last name of the passenger for whom the baggage should be added
- Confirmation of your agreement with the applicable surcharge
Our team will process your request and update your booking accordingly.
